Lindsay Aerts is a podcast host and journalist with a background in politics and current events. She has worked as a reporter and editor for various publications and has interviewed numerous public figures. Aerts is known for her in-depth research and thoughtful questioning. She has a strong online presence and is active on social media platforms. Aerts is based in the United States.
